WATCH: How concerned should we be about the 'screwworm?'
Dr. Ann Hohenhaus, senior veterinarian and director of pet health information at Schwarzman Animal Medical Center, discusses the 'new world screwworm' detected in a baby cow in Texas. The article addresses concerns about the parasite.
